What companies run services between Quebec, QC, Canada and Oslo, Norway?

There is no direct connection from Quebec to Oslo. However, you can take the line 80 bus to Aérogare, walk to Québec City Jean Lesage International Airport (YQB) airport, fly to Oslo Airport, Gardermoen (OSL), walk to Oslo lufthavn stasjon, then take the train to Oslo S. Alternatively, you can take the bus to Montreal Airport, walk to Montréal–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port (YUL) airport, fly to Oslo Airport, Gardermoen (OSL), walk to Oslo lufthavn stasjon, then take the train to Oslo S.
